A power of attorney is a legal document that allows an individual to appoint someone else to act on their behalf in making financial, legal, or medical decisions.
The person who wishes to grant someone else the authority to act on their behalf is required to file a power of attorney.
To fill out a power of attorney form, you need to provide personal information about yourself and the person you are appointing as your agent. You will also need to specify the powers you are granting to your agent and sign the form in the presence of a notary public or witness, depending on the requirements of your jurisdiction.
The purpose of a power of attorney is to give someone else the legal authority to make decisions and act on your behalf when you are unable to do so yourself due to physical or mental incapacity, absence, or any other reason.
The information that must be reported on a power of attorney form includes the names and contact information of both the principal (the person granting the power) and the agent (the person receiving the power), the specific powers being granted, and the date the power of attorney is executed.
